Due to the fact that WPC products are prone to fatal defects like fading, the growth of mildew, and surface cracking, many businesses have been forced to deal with return complaints regarding these issues. The process of co-extrusion has the potential to fundamentally and effectively solve these problems, and it is currently being researched. It requires covering the wood-plastic core with a very thin layer of polymer and sealing it off in all 360 degrees. The typical warranty on wood-plastic flooring is 20 years, but several companies with headquarters in North America are now offering longer warranties of up to 25 years on their products.
